In 2000, Simon Kirwan was named The Observer Outdoor Photographer of the Year and has travelled extensively in Europe, USA, Asia and Africa, photographing people, places and mountains for The Lightbox Picture Library, which now contains over 20,000 images. He is the author and photographer of a series of regional landscape and aerial photography books for Myriad Books, and is equally at home in corporate offices, construction sites, light aircraft, mountain summits, live music concerts, convention centres, trade shows, exhibition venues, or sport stadia. Simon Kirwan is the official in-house photographer at BT Convention Centre Liverpool, and covers many corporate events, conventions and conferences at the venue for event organisers, and for ACC Liverpool, operators of BTCC.
Simon Kirwan has trekked in the Himalayas, driven across East Africa in a truck, and photographed the cities and landscapes of Europe, USA and New Zealand. He can make all the necessary arrangements for a location photo-shoot, including models, stylists, assistants, locations, fixers, pilots, aircraft, flights, vehicles, and accommodation.
Simon Kirwan also specialises in photography of the built environment, from the ground and the air. He has carried out aerial photography in the United Kingdom, Holland, Belgium and Poland, and has travelled all over the UK photographing properties for a major international hotel chain. All photography is produced using the latest state-of-the-art digital camera gear, and utilises a fully digital workflow from image capture to client approval and distribution via the Lightbox online image management system, providing instant access to high-resolution images for clients and media partners. The Lightbox is one of the UK’s longest-established photographic web sites, originally set up in 1995. Simon Kirwan is a member of the Association of Photographers and the National Union of Journalists.
